Bank of Baroda
Bank of Baroda is a central public sector organisation, founded in 1908, which operates under the purview of the Indian ministry of finance. The bank is headquartered in Vadodara, India. It is the second largest public sector undertaking (PSU) in India, in terms of market capitalisation, and a global presence through its overseas offices. During the assessed period the reported number of employees was 75515 and total assets corresponding to USD 192 billion were reported.
Leading practices
The financial institution specifies that it does not make political contributions. The financial institution assigns decision-making and oversight responsibility for its sustainability strategy to the highest governance body. The financial institution discloses the amount and/or share (in monetary terms) products, services and capital provided to small-and medium-sized enterprises.
Risks and opportunities
The institution has the opportunity to disclose its method for determining a living wage in its operational regions and to include anti-bribery and anti-corruption clauses in contracts. It identifies material sustainability impacts but could provide more detail on the criteria and evidence used for their prioritisation. Linking senior executive remuneration to specific sustainability targets is recommended.
While there are targets for climate solutions, these could be better defined in terms of time and measurability. The institution discloses its scope 1-2 emissions but should clarify scope 2 emissions as market-based or location-based and monitor scope 3 emissions by category. Transparency in the methodology for footprint calculation is advised, along with a commitment to reducing scope 1-3 emissions in line with interim targets.
A breakdown of clients by income group and a risk assessment process that includes ILO fundamental rights at work is recommended, along with a mitigation process for identified risks. Additionally, the institution should identify social risks related to the net zero transition and provide an example of actions taken regarding salient human rights issues from assessments in the past three years.
